(ALZHEIMERS) A closer Look at the Dise ase Alzheimer's disease is a form of dementia characterized by declining memory and other thinking skills caused by damage to nerve cells in the brain. This disease can cause changes in... Memory Behavior * The ability to think clearly In Alzheimer's disease, this damage can impair basic bodily functions, such as walking and swallowing. Alzheimer’s disease is a form of dementia that affects millions of Americans. This condition is more common in older adults, but has been known to appear in younger adults, as well. This disease has...
